10 inspirational 'big magic' quotes to keep your dreams on track

5/20/2017

Comments

 
Picture
News flash: I am a self-confessed and rather obsessed Elizabeth Gilbert fan.

​But unlike most, it's not her 'Eat Pray Love' vibes that hold me to ransom, but rather the pages of her recent 'Big Magic' masterpiece that equally inspire me and keep me in  check when I'm experiencing my most intense moments of self-doubt and vulnerability.
​I would encourage everyone to get their heads into this book pronto, but if you don't have the time to read the whole thing from front to back, I've extracted some of my most favourite quotes to keep you going until you DO get the chance to read it........
​

​


'Big Magic' Quote 1.
​"So this, I believe, is the central question upon which all creative living hinges: Do you have the courage to bring forth the treasures that are hidden within you?"

​
'Big Magic' Quote 2.
​"The universe buries strange jewels deep within us all, and then stands back to see if we can find them"

'Big Magic' Quote 3.
​​" I believe that our planet is inhabited not only by animals and bacteria and viruses but also by ideas"

​'
Big Magic' Quote 4.
​"..you will never be able to create anything interesting out of your life if you don't believe you're entitled to at least try"

​>>(this one depends on you believing in yourself in your own right, without depending on others to believe in you. Self-love and self-care are the key denominators here.)

'Big Magic' Quote 5.
​"...without (creative entitlement) this arrogance of belonging, you will never push yourself out of the suffocating insulation of personal safety and into the frontiers of the beautiful and the unexpected"

>>I used to live in a façade of 'busy-ness' making myself so busy that my appearance depended on it; I got a reputation for it, but I also received positive reinforcement for all the things I was achieving, so I inherently thought that I was succeeding in life, that this is how it felt to succeed and achieve.

What's your insulation of personal safety?? Mine used to be a montage of "should be's": 'I should stay on my current career path because it's the right thing to do, and I've spent over a decade working my way through the university degrees, spent a lot of money along the way, have a huge mortgage to pay off and now I have to keep staying here to be able to provide my kids with the same opportunity......The 'same opportunity'....for what??!!

​
'Big Magic' Quote
6.

"..Defending yourself as a creative person begins by defining yourself. It begins when you declare your intent"

'Big Magic' Quote 7.
"(Trust me, your soul has been waiting for you to wake up to your own existence for years)"

Yes, yes, yes & yes!!

'Big Magic' Quote 8.
​"Speak to your darkest and most negative interior voices the way a hostage negotiator speaks to a violent psychopath: calmly, but firmly. Most of all, never back down. you cannot afford to back down. The life you are negotiating to save, after all, is your own".

'Big Magic' Quote 9.
​"..maybe you fear that you are not original enough.
​...maybe that's the problem - your ideas are commonplace and pedestrian and therefore unworthy of creation........
well, yes, it probably has already been done, most things have (been) - but.....THEY HAVE NOT YET BEEN DONE BY YOU!"

This one stays with me all the time - and whenever I doubt the originality of one of my ideas or concepts, I hear this quote in my head and push through it and throw it out there anyway, because the worst that can happen is that your idea or concept gets rejected, and who cares??!! As long as you believed in it at the time and felt its energy and presence, no-one can take that away from you. So push through the fear and throw it out into the world, no matter how zany or crazy it sounds.

'Big Magic' Quote 10.
​"So the question is not so much 'what are you passionate about'?; the question is 'what are you passionate enough about that you can endure the most disagreeable aspects of the work'?
​..
Because if you love and want something enough....then you don't mind the shit sandwich that comes with it".

LOVE LOVE LOVE this one!!
